On December 20 the Federal
Security Service of Russia will celebrate its 91-st anniversary.
Director of the Regional office
of the RF Federal Security Service over the Tyumen Region Sergei
Zaveiboroda said that peculiarities of Ugra Security Service employees
was caused by concentration of facilities in the fuel and energy
sector in the region, interest of foreign countries to them, great
migration process. In this regard key tasks of the Ugra office of the
RF Federal Security Service are the support of these facilities
safety, protection of citizens from terrorism and extremism,
counteraction to secret services of foreign countries, anti-corruption
activities, counteraction to trans-border criminal groups which are
engaged in drugs and arms distribution.

The Nizhnevartovsk District
ranked the first in the III All-Russia contest among the
municipalities of the Russian Federation in the nomination "The best
municipality".
The selection was made in 15
nominations to determine the best municipality in the sphere of
providing the information support to the reform of local authorities,
the best municipal officer, best highlight in mass media of the local
authorities reform implementation, best practice of communal sector
management, best municipal district and etc.
This year 38 Russian regions
participated in the competition, the Nizhnevartovsk District became
the winner.
On November 17 at the Minor Hall
of the State Duma of the RF Federal Assembly the head of the District
Boris Salomatin was awarded with the diploma of the contest winner.
The All-Russia competition is
held annually and Ugra municipalities traditionally participate in it.
The Nizhnevartovsk District was represented for the third time. In
2006 Boris Salomatin ranked the third in the nomination "The best
mayor of the municipality".
